Poets, with no sponsors, no agenda, are the truest form of freedom today, bleeding out every drop of themselves for the world to either hate or devour.

This quote encapsulates the profound notion that genuine artistic expression often requires liberation from external influences and constraints. When poets or creators produce art without the backing of sponsors or predefined agendas, they are free to explore the depths of their personal vision, emotions, and truths. This unfiltered honesty exemplifies freedom of thought and expression, allowing their work to be raw, authentic, and vulnerable. It suggests that in an era where commercial interests and societal expectations can profoundly shape art, the most sincere form of artistry remains that which is unshackled by such forces, risking rejection or misinterpretation.

The metaphor of bleeding out every drop of oneself emphasizes the intensity and sacrifice involved in such pure expression. It portrays creation as a shedding of superficial layers, exposing the core of the creator's identity and feelings, regardless of how the world perceives or consumes it. This process can be painful but also incredibly liberating, as it embodies an act of surrender and honesty that echoes the core of artistic integrity.

In a broader context, this highlights the importance of independence in creativity and the value of maintaining integrity amidst commercial and societal pressures. The quote invites reflection on the role of art as a mirror to society and the importance of nurturing spaces where genuine voices can emerge freely. It champions the idea that true art nurtures vulnerability and originality, ultimately becoming a powerful force for both self-expression and societal critique.
